Sparkling, soaring music of Bolivia and Peru!



Album Rating: (4 of 5 stars)
Review Comments: Eddy Navia, Enrique Coria, Alcides Mejia and Quentin Howard offer clever arrangements of traditional Andean songs as well as original compositions inspired by time-honored techniques. Navia's charango (a tiny Bolivian guitar) sparkles, Mejia and Howard's winds soar, Coria's guitar provides a rich and steady grounding, and shouts, handclaps and drumming complete the ambience. Joining the group for this recording are David Grisman on mandolin and Adolfo Rodriguez on winds. As on Sukay's previous album, "Cumbre", most of the selections on "Return of the Inca" are upbeat and fairly quick in tempo. This cheerful, celebratory music with its distinctive, varying rhythms is ideal for driving or working, and is a particularly good pick-you-up in the middle of an otherwise drowsy afternoon.
